The Daimler Six is powered by a 4.0-liter inline-six, serving up 237 hp and 277 lb-ft of torque, paired with a four-speed automatic. These were respectable figures for an inline-six at the time ...
The Daimler Super Eight is a supercharged Jaguar XJ with a fully redone interior, special exterior colors, and the distinctive Daimler grille.
